TIP: It is important to have full-fat heavy whipping cream, meaning it contains at least 36 percent or more of fat. In my experience, the cheaper brands have not worked very well. Use a high quality organic heavy whipping cream for quality results.

Fresh Whipped Cream Recipe

Dessert

Gluten free

Fresh Whipped Cream Recipe and How-To Make it at Home in under 1 minute! Using one simple ingredient and the easiest way to quickly whip up and store your fresh whipped cream. {Gluten-Free}
Print Recipe

Yield: 2 and 1/2 cups whipped cream

Prep Time: 1 min

Cook Time: 0 min

Total Time: 1 min

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ups cold heavy whipping cream
  • Optional: 2 Tablespoons honey

Directions:

  1. In a cold medium bowl or mason jar with immersion blender, beat heavy cream (and honey if desired) to stiff peaks, then refrigerate.
  2. https://youtu.be/LVwSC8migAw {See Video Demo}
  3. Store in the refrigerator up to 3-4 days. May need to quickly re-whip it before serving after a couple days.
